Even a case of a police officer firing a beam at a car to determine its speed... that's causing change. The photon hits the car, the car absorbs evergy, and the conditions have changed (albeit in an immeasureable way).
When you realise that in order to measure the velocity and trajectory of a partcle, or even a large physical object such as the moon, one needs to at the very least fire photons at it, then you can start to see that you're changing the conditions in which the object you're measuring was intitially subject to. Yes, in a tiny manner, and for all practical purposes on the macro scale, the change is zero. But it's not actually zero. When we get to the quantum level, well it becomes much less nelgigible.
